Transaction 09503db7aafdb96d135546c3248587a4c5e70a65ed8649337d02cf766d101586
1 Input
1 Output
-
09503db7aafdb96d135546c3248587a4c5e70a65ed8649337d02cf766d101586:0
- value
- 8141723
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b400f5b12c656cbec8eeb5f643808bd9b0be092 OP_EQUAL
- address
- 35dhikvdxem1ghbG7TbvYVUtq1TtE5oab7